Bulgarians are optimistic coronavirus spread would subside

3 out of 4 Bulgarians are following the coronavirus information in this country and around the world with increased interest, according to a study by Alpha Research Agency. The limited number cases in Bulgaria is somewhat reassuring to the respondents. 75% of Bulgarians are optimistic that the epidemic will soon disappear. Only 11 percent are worried about the COVID-19 situation. The highest levels of anxiety are registered among young people. The group of the elderly who are also the group at the highest risk is the least worried. This is explained by the greater mobility of young people and the lower activity of the elderly. 67% approve of the measures taken by the authorities. 19 per cent want them more stringent, while 14 per cent say measures are too stringent.
